<title>input: Change LED state bits to conform i8042 compatible keyboard</title>
<updated>2015-11-20T03:13:42+00:00</updated>
<author>
<name>Bin Meng</name>
<email>bmeng.cn@gmail.com</email>
</author>
<published>2015-11-12T13:33:03+00:00</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://cgit.235523.xyz/u-boot.git/commit/?id=377a06964370bd887ec15f77f3e4e179c27fe8b9'/>
<id>377a06964370bd887ec15f77f3e4e179c27fe8b9</id>
<content type='text'>
When sending LED update command to an i8042 compatible keyboard,
bit1 is 'Num Lock' and bit2 is 'Caps Lock' in the data byte. But
input library defines bit1 as 'Caps Lock' and bit2 as 'Num Lock'.
This causes a wrong LED to be set on an i8042 compatible keyboard.
Change the LED state bits to be i8042 compatible, and change the
keyboard flags as well.

<title>i8042: Handle a duplicate power-on-reset response</title>
<updated>2015-11-20T03:13:41+00:00</updated>
<author>
<name>Simon Glass</name>
<email>sjg@chromium.org</email>
</author>
<published>2015-11-11T17:05:46+00:00</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://cgit.235523.xyz/u-boot.git/commit/?id=011d89d6066592a67253df81905ace358968dacc'/>
<id>011d89d6066592a67253df81905ace358968dacc</id>
<content type='text'>
Sometimes we seem to get 0xaa twice which causes the config read to fail.
This causes chromebook_link to fail to set up the keyboard.

Add a check for this and read the config again when detected.
